Bryant Ridge's Analysis:
The V. Bernardelli Model 80, imported into the United States by Interarms, represents one of the more refined yet underrated service-style semi-automatic pistols of the late 20th century. Produced in Italy by the historic Vincenzo Bernardelli firm—known for its high-quality firearms dating back to the 1800s—the Model 80 reflects European police and military design priorities of the era, offering a compact steel frame, smooth double-action/single-action trigger system, reliable fixed-barrel accuracy, and durable construction. Interarms brought these pistols into the U.S. market as a competitively priced alternative to Beretta and SIG pistols, giving American shooters access to Italian craftsmanship without premium pricing. Today, Model 80s remain appealing to collectors and enthusiasts who appreciate well-made European service pistols, especially those tied to import history and manufacturers no longer in operation.
